首先是你的项目中有和和历史不符的东西 Push rejected: Push to origin/development was rejected 推拒绝:推送到起源/开发被拒绝 直接是解决办法,直接打开你要上传代码的文件夹位置鼠标右键git Bash Here然后直接下面两行命令解决问题 git pull origin development –allow-unrelated-histories (运行这句会报错) git ...
如果当前分支与多个主机存在追踪关系,则可以使用-u选项指定一个默认主机,这样后面就可以不加任何参数使用git push。 $ git push -u origin master 上面命令将本地的master分支推送到origin主机,同时指定origin为默认主机,后面就可以不加任何参数使用git push了。 不带任何参数的git push,默认只推送当前分支,这叫做sim...
git push origin命令用于将本地代码推送到远程仓库。具体来说,”git push”用于将本地提交的代码推送到一个远程分支上,”origin”是远程仓库的名称,通常为”origin”,它表示要将代码推送到哪个远程仓库。该命令的完整语法是: git push origin <本地分支名>:<远程分支名> 其中,”<本地分支名>“表示要推送的本...
Every time I try to push to the repository, I end up having to create a new ssh key and it has become a real pain in the you know what. However, I
✅ 最佳回答: 这两个都是Git上存储库中分支的名称。 主分支是代码库中的主分支,现在它在Git中以主分支而闻名。 因此,当您向存储库添加更改时,您可以在存储库中使用git push origin master或git push origin main。 如果假设您将name dev作为分支名称,则需要使用该名称,如: git push origin dev ...
git push <远程仓库名称> <本地分支>:<远程分支> 也就是将本地的dev分支推送到远程origin的dev分支, 这个名字不一定非要一样, 也可以:git push origin dev:mydev 这样就是将本地的dev分支推送到远程的mydev分支 同时, 这个命令还可以用于删除远程分支, 只需要将本地分支省略掉:git push origin...
当您在执行 `git push -u origin main` 命令时遇到“重复”错误,通常是因为远程仓库已经存在一个与本地分支同名的分支,并且您尝试再次推送相同的分支。 ### 基础概念 - **...
总之,`git push origin` 是一个重要的 Git 命令,用于将本地分支推送到远程仓库,并使其他开发人员能够访问和同步这些更改。在使用该命令之前,请确保你有推送到远程仓库的权限,并小心地审查和测试你的更改。 推送本地分支到远程仓库是使用Git的一个常见操作,可以使用以下方法来实现。
gitpushorigin gitpushorigin $ git push origin :master # 等同于 $ git push origin --delete master 上⾯命令表⽰删除origin主机的master分⽀。如果当前分⽀与远程分⽀之间存在追踪关系,则本地分⽀和远程分⽀都可以省略。$ git push origin 上⾯命令表⽰,将当前分⽀推送到origin主机的对应...
如上,通过命令行git push origin --delete branch会删除远程分支和追踪分支,不需要单独删除追踪分支,但是如果通过网页对远程分支进行删除,追踪分支是不会被删除的. 在git版本1.6.6之后,可以通过git fetch origin --prune或它的简写git fetch origin -p来单独删除追踪...